Lunever wrote:How do I get at hte Elven boots and the stormring at 03/19/15 (Encyclopaedia coordinates)? Entering that corridor teleports the party immediately into the pit at the end of the corridor. <br> <p>Komm zur bunten Seite der Macht! </p>
You have to time it right, by allowing the party to face the alcove containing prizes, take one at a time whilst stepping right, against the teleport. this should work for you. Finish by stepping right back onto the zoom trail.
